Transaction fd22da04fc264ab7217a6916e3bff3122402b4d87408c3a53f5ee4b6d89dea66

1 Input
2 Outputs
  • fd22da04fc264ab7217a6916e3bff3122402b4d87408c3a53f5ee4b6d89dea66:0
  • value  269500
    address  1TuFfn17zAErHthtxocgdxjw66tnNMgtn
  • fd22da04fc264ab7217a6916e3bff3122402b4d87408c3a53f5ee4b6d89dea66:1
  • value  35635300
    address  33ac89DiE1ahUWkYwau7R34puLQuAaaKra